Natzweiler-Struthof

Natzweiler-Struthof – a Nazi concentration camp near the French town of Natzwiler (German: Natzweiler) in German-occupied Alsace. From May 1941 to November 1944, approximately 52,000 prisoners from all over Europe passed through the camp. About 22,000 of them died or were murdered there.
